Our family is big on grilling out, so it’s always disappointing when the cold weather forces us to pack away our grill until warmer weather returns. But this year we expect to enjoy delicious grilled foods indoors all winter long thanks to our new Breville Smart Grill!

We’ve used other contact grills in the past, but they’ve always fallen somewhat short of our expectations. The plates weren’t easy to clean. The grills weren’t large enough to cook enough food for our family at one time. And they were all limited to use as a clamshell-type grill. But the Breville Smart Grill met and/or exceeded our expectations in every area:

  • The Smart Grill opens flat into a 260 square inch BBQ surface. I love this because I can cook bacon or sausage on one wide, while making pancakes on the other easily.
  • Whether you use it closed or in BBQ mode, all of the excess fat and oils drain into one central drip tray that’s easy to empty.
  • The grill plates on the Smart Grill are removable for easy cleaning. And even better — they’re dishwasher safe. Yay!

The Breville Smart Grill offers the latest in grilling technology with their Element IQ feature. Element IQ compensates for the drop in grill temperature when you place cold foods on the surface by injecting heat into the plates for rapid recovery back to the selected cooking temperature. This allows you to get those great sear marks that make for flavorful grilled meats.
